FC Porto extended their impressive domestic momentum on Sunday, 23 August 2026, securing a clinical 2–0 victory over a resilient Arouca side in their latest Primeira Liga fixture. Playing in front of a fervent home support at the Estádio do Dragão, the Dragons controlled the tempo from the opening whistle, suffocating their opponents' build-up play and establishing territorial dominance that ultimately yielded a comfortable three points. Despite Arouca's disciplined defensive block, Porto’s relentless pressure eventually cracked the visitors' resolve, showcasing the tactical maturity and attacking depth that makes Sergio Conceição’s outfit genuine title contenders this term.
The breakthrough arrived in the first half courtesy of sustained offensive waves that had been building since kickoff, as Porto's midfield orchestrators began to find pockets of space between the lines. Arouca’s backline stood firm under intense duress, relying on timely interceptions and desperate clearances to keep the scoreboard level, but the relentless white-and-blue tide proved too difficult to stem indefinitely. The hosts finally broke the deadlock with a brilliantly constructed team goal that sliced through the heart of the defense, sending the home faithful into raptures and forcing the visitors to abandon their cautious tactical approach.
With the visitors chasing an equalizer in the second half, Porto capitalised on the resulting transitional spaces to add a crucial insurance goal, effectively extinguishing any hopes of a late Arouca comeback. The defensive unit remained impenetrable throughout the ninety minutes, comfortably neutralizing any counter-attacking threats and preserving a well-earned clean sheet to cap off a professional masterclass. As the final whistle echoed across the stadium, this decisive 2–0 triumph served as another emphatic statement of intent from Porto, reinforcing their ambitions at the summit of the Primeira Liga table.
